Contraception is achieved through the use of contraceptive methods and the treatment of infertility. Contraceptive information and services are fundamental to the health and human rights of all individuals.
The prevention of unintended pregnancies helps to lower maternal ill-health and the number of pregnancy-related deaths. Delaying pregnancies in young girls who are at increased risk of health problems from early childbearing.
Although contraception among young and unmarried girls is frowned at in Africa it does not stop the fact that these wayward girls are doing what they are not supposed to do. They are getting pregnant, indulging in abortion that has resulted in damage of wombs or untimely death.
Also, preventing pregnancies among older women who may face increased risks, are important health benefit of family planning.
By reducing rates of unintended pregnancies, contraception will reduce unsafe abortion and reduces HIV transmissions from mothers to newborns.
This can also improve the education of girls and create opportunities for women to participate more fully in society, including paid employment. In 2017, it was estimated that 214 million women of reproductive age in developing regions have an unmet need for contraception.
Reasons for this include:
*Fear or experience of side-effects
*Cultural or religious opposition
*Limited access to contraception
*Limited choice of methods
*Poor quality of available services
*Gender-based barriers.
